What is an Edgy Space?

An edgy space is characterized by its bold and unconventional design elements. It often features a mix of contrasting colors, textures, and materials. The goal is to create an atmosphere that is visually striking and leaves a lasting impression. Edgy spaces are not afraid to challenge traditional design norms and can be a great way to express your personal style.

Choosing the Right Colors

When it comes to decorating an edgy space, color plays a crucial role. Opt for bold and vibrant colors such as deep blues, rich reds, or dark greens. These colors can add a sense of drama and intensity to your space. Consider using contrasting colors to create a visually striking effect.

Statement Pieces

One of the key elements of an edgy space is the use of statement pieces. These are bold and eye-catching furniture or decorative items that serve as the focal point of the room. Think oversized artwork, unique lighting fixtures, or a statement sofa. These pieces can instantly transform a space and add a touch of edginess.

Textures and Materials

Experimenting with textures and materials can also help create an edgy atmosphere. Consider incorporating elements such as exposed brick, raw concrete, or distressed wood. These materials add an industrial and gritty feel to the space. Mixing different textures, such as velvet, leather, and metal, can also create a visually interesting and edgy look.

Lighting

The right lighting can make a significant difference in an edgy space. Opt for unconventional lighting fixtures that make a statement. Industrial-style pendant lights, oversized floor lamps, or neon signs can add a touch of edginess to your space. Consider using dimmers to create different moods and enhance the overall atmosphere.

Minimalist Approach

While edgy spaces are often characterized by bold and unconventional design elements, adopting a minimalist approach can also create a striking and edgy look. Embrace clean lines, simplicity, and a less-is-more mentality. Focus on a few key pieces and let them shine.

Artwork and Accessories

Artwork and accessories are another great way to add personality and edginess to your space. Opt for abstract or contemporary artwork that adds a pop of color and visual interest. Display unique sculptures or decorative items that reflect your personal style. Remember, less is more, so choose a few carefully curated pieces that make a statement.

Creating a Cozy Corner

An edgy space doesn’t have to sacrifice comfort. Create a cozy corner where you can relax and unwind. Add a comfortable chair or a plush sofa, layer with textured pillows and throws, and incorporate soft lighting. This will create a perfect balance between edginess and coziness.
